How Does Littering Damage the Environment?

Littering, the irresponsible disposal of waste, inflicts profound and multifaceted damage on our environment by polluting ecosystems, harming wildlife, and degrading the aesthetic value of our communities. Beyond the unsightly appearance, the environmental consequences of carelessly discarded materials ripple through the natural world, impacting air, water, and soil quality.

Physical Impacts: A Chain of Negative Consequences

The physical impact of litter is perhaps the most immediately visible. Plastic bags, for example, can choke waterways, hindering drainage and increasing the risk of flooding. Discarded fishing line and plastic rings pose a significant entanglement hazard to wildlife, leading to injury, starvation, and even death. Broken glass and sharp metal can cause physical harm to animals and humans alike. Furthermore, large items dumped illegally, like furniture or appliances, can obstruct natural habitats and alter ecosystem dynamics.

Chemical Pollution: A Toxic Legacy

The chemical pollution stemming from litter is often insidious and long-lasting. Decomposing organic waste releases harmful greenhouse gases like methane, contributing to climate change. Plastic waste, which can take hundreds or even thousands of years to degrade, leaches harmful chemicals into the soil and water, contaminating groundwater and potentially entering the food chain. Discarded batteries release heavy metals like lead and mercury, which are toxic to both humans and wildlife and can persist in the environment for decades.

Biological Disruption: Upsetting the Balance of Life

Litter can significantly disrupt biological processes within ecosystems. Introduced pathogens and invasive species can hitchhike on discarded items, spreading to new environments and outcompeting native flora and fauna. Changes in soil composition due to litter accumulation can alter plant growth patterns and affect the entire food web. Animals may also ingest litter, mistaking it for food, which can lead to malnutrition, internal injuries, and even death.

Frequently Asked Questions (FAQs) About Littering and the Environment

1. How long does it take for common litter items to decompose?

The decomposition rate of litter varies drastically depending on the material. Paper can decompose in a few weeks or months, while aluminum cans take 80-200 years. Plastic bags can take hundreds of years to break down, and glass bottles are estimated to take a million years or more. The variability highlights the long-term consequences of even seemingly insignificant acts of littering.

2. What are the main types of litter found in the environment?

The most common types of litter include plastics (bags, bottles, food wrappers), paper products (cups, newspapers, fast food containers), cigarette butts, food waste, and metal items (cans, foil). Construction debris and discarded appliances also contribute significantly in some areas.

3. How does litter impact marine life?

Litter, particularly plastic, poses a severe threat to marine life. Sea turtles often mistake plastic bags for jellyfish and ingest them, leading to starvation. Seabirds ingest plastic pellets, which can damage their digestive systems and reduce their appetite. Marine mammals can become entangled in plastic netting and fishing gear, leading to drowning or severe injuries. Microplastics, tiny plastic particles resulting from the breakdown of larger items, contaminate the food chain and can accumulate in the tissues of marine organisms.

4. What are microplastics, and why are they a concern?

Microplastics are plastic particles less than 5 millimeters in diameter. They originate from the breakdown of larger plastic items, microbeads used in cosmetics and personal care products, and plastic fibers released from synthetic clothing during washing. They are a concern because they are pervasive in the environment, easily ingested by marine life, and can accumulate in the food chain, potentially posing a threat to human health.

5. How does litter affect soil quality?

Litter can contaminate soil with harmful chemicals, alter its pH levels, and inhibit plant growth. Plastic pollution prevents water and air from penetrating the soil, hindering the decomposition of organic matter and disrupting nutrient cycles. Heavy metals from discarded batteries and electronics can accumulate in the soil, making it toxic to plants and animals.

6. What is the relationship between littering and climate change?

Littering contributes to climate change through several mechanisms. Decomposing organic waste releases methane, a potent greenhouse gas. The production and transportation of litter items, particularly plastic, require significant energy inputs, leading to greenhouse gas emissions. Furthermore, litter can reduce the capacity of ecosystems to sequester carbon, as polluted soils and waters support less plant life.

7. What are the economic costs associated with littering?

The economic costs of littering are substantial and include the cost of cleanup efforts, the loss of tourism revenue in areas affected by litter, the damage to infrastructure caused by litter-related flooding, and the impact on property values in littered areas. Businesses also bear the cost of managing waste and preventing litter on their premises.

8. What can individuals do to reduce littering?

Individuals can significantly reduce littering by properly disposing of waste in designated bins, participating in community cleanup events, reducing their consumption of single-use plastics, recycling whenever possible, choosing reusable alternatives (e.g., water bottles, shopping bags), and educating others about the importance of proper waste management.

9. What role do businesses play in preventing littering?

Businesses have a crucial role to play in preventing littering by providing adequate waste disposal facilities for customers, using sustainable packaging materials, promoting recycling programs, implementing anti-littering policies, and educating their employees and customers about the importance of proper waste management.

10. What are some effective government policies for reducing littering?

Effective government policies for reducing littering include stiff penalties for littering, increased funding for waste management infrastructure, public awareness campaigns, mandatory recycling programs, extended producer responsibility schemes (where manufacturers are responsible for the end-of-life management of their products), and bans on single-use plastics.

11. How does illegal dumping differ from littering, and what are its consequences?

Illegal dumping involves the deliberate disposal of large quantities of waste in unauthorized locations, such as abandoned properties, forests, or waterways. Unlike littering, which often involves small amounts of waste discarded carelessly, illegal dumping typically involves significant volumes of waste, including hazardous materials. The consequences of illegal dumping are severe, including soil and water contamination, habitat destruction, increased risk of disease transmission, and degradation of property values.

12. What is the “broken windows theory” in relation to littering?

The “broken windows theory” suggests that visible signs of crime and disorder, such as litter and graffiti, can create an environment that encourages further crime and antisocial behavior. In the context of littering, this means that areas with existing litter are more likely to attract further littering, leading to a downward spiral of environmental degradation and social decay. Conversely, maintaining clean and well-maintained environments can deter littering and promote a sense of civic pride.
